Bessie May Ford 1904–1979 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 26 Feb 1904

Birth Location: New Liberty, Pope, Illinois, United States

Death Date: Jul 1979

Death Location: Pope County, Illinois, USA

Father: James Ford

Mother: Therisa McCurdy

Spouse(s): Freeman Bell

Children(s): Ruth Bell, Billie Bell, Dorothy Bell, Flo Bell, Elsie Bell, Alberta Bell, Junior Bell

Bessie May Ford was born in 1904 in New Liberty, Pope, Illinois, United States, the child of James Mitchell Ford And Therisa Josephine Mccurdy. In 1930, Bessie May Ford resided in Jefferson, Pope, Illinois. In 1935, Bessie May Ford resided in Jefferson, Pope, Illinois. Bessie May Ford married Freeman Albert Bell, and had children including Alberta Louise Bell, Billie Joe Bell, Dorothy Marie Bell, Elsie May Bell, Flo Evelene Bell, Junior Bell, Ruth Virginia Bell. Bessie May Ford passed away in 1979 in Pope County, Illinois, USA.
